Transaction e4c205983afa112f234c7213aa22c809ab200172851d285af45526af58f04d1e
1 Input
1 Output
-
e4c205983afa112f234c7213aa22c809ab200172851d285af45526af58f04d1e:0
- value
- 619241
- script pubkey
- OP_0 OP_PUSHBYTES_20 eecf3ec4fe12a5b6af2c7fa7a760ccf57a17d2e2
- address
- bc1qam8na387z2jmdtev07n6wcxv74ap05hzcuhh4r